The Indian leg of the Def Leppard tour has been postponed.
“We are sorry to report that due to unforseen circumstances of the Indian government suddenly calling May elections (and making certain venues now unavailable for any music or sporting events), the two Indian shows that were supposed to take place in Bangalore and Mumbai on May 16 and 18, have been postponed. At this moment, the band is working on rescheduling these shows for dates in the fall. Our apologies to all our fans in India!”
Banglore is to hold elections this May.
There are rumors floating around that the show will be rescheduled to somewhere around July-August, which seems plausible since the UK/EU leg of the tour finishes around that time.
